Introduction

Virginia Woolf and James Joyce are iconic figures in modernist literature, critically engaging with significant social issues of the early 20th century including gender equality, class injustice, and the psychological aftermath of industrialization and war. This analysis explores how these two renowned authors addressed and critiqued pertinent social concerns in their influential works.

Gender Equality and Women's Rights

Both Virginia Woolf and James Joyce tackled the evolving dynamics of gender roles and women's rights during the suffrage movement. Woolf's essays and novels, particularly 'A Room of One's Own', emphasize the urgent need for women's independence and equal educational opportunities. Her argument for financial and personal freedom is pivotal for empowering women writers. Joyce indirectly engages with female autonomy as well, portraying complex female characters like Molly Bloom in 'Ulysses', who navigates traditional expectations while embodying progressive aspirations.

  • Woolf championed women's independence and educational access.
  • Joyce illustrated the complexities of female characters navigating societal norms.

Class Struggle and Social Inequity

The early 20th century witnessed intense class struggles driven by rapid industrialization. Virginia Woolf's 'Mrs. Dalloway' astutely reveals class disparities by contrasting the privileged lives of the wealthy with the hardships faced by lower classes, particularly in the aftermath of war. Joyce's 'Dubliners' vividly captures the challenges and limitations endured by Dublin's working class, exposing the stagnant social conditions fostering despair. Both Woolf and Joyce's narratives serve as critiques of the entrenched class system and highlight the plight of marginalized communities.

  • Woolf illustrated class inequities through character interactions and insightful social commentary.
  • Joyce focused on the working class struggles, highlighting themes of societal stagnation and entrapment.

War and its Psychological Trauma

The repercussions of World War I significantly influenced the literary expressions of both Virginia Woolf and James Joyce. Woolf's 'Mrs. Dalloway' intricately examines the psychological ramifications of war on veterans, especially through the character Septimus Warren Smith, who grapples with shell shock. In contrast, Joyce's 'A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man' delves into identity crisis and exile, mirroring the chaos caused by war. Additionally, Joyce's later work, 'Finnegans Wake', addresses themes of post-war trauma, reflecting the intricate realities of modern life and shaping contemporary consciousness.

  • Woolf investigated war's mental health impacts through characters like Septimus.
  • Joyce explored themes of identity crisis, trauma, and existential dislocation.

Conclusion

The literary contributions of Woolf and Joyce provide deep insights into the critical social topics of gender equality, class struggles, and the effects of war in the early 20th century. Their timeless works continue to resonate today, reflecting the ongoing challenges faced by society and the nuanced complexities of the human experience.
